A number is selected at random from first 50 natural numbers. Find the probability that it is a multiple of 3 and 4.
Total number of outcomes = 50
Let E be the event of getting a number which is a multiple of 3 and 4.
Now, the common multiples of 3 and 4 among first 50 natural numbers are 12, 24, 36 and 48.
So, the favourable number of outcomes are 4.
